Stamina, at its core, is the ability to sustain prolonged physical or mental effort. It's not just about raw power or speed, but the capacity to maintain that power and speed over an extended period. This is where the myth of the unlimited stamina guy often takes hold. We see someone who excels in endurance activities, whether it's running marathons, crushing CrossFit workouts, or simply maintaining a high level of activity throughout the day, and we assume they've unlocked some secret to limitless energy. However, the truth is that stamina, like any other physical attribute, is subject to the laws of physiology and the realities of life. Several factors can influence stamina, including genetics, training, nutrition, sleep, stress, and age. Genetics play a role in our baseline stamina levels, determining things like muscle fiber composition and oxygen uptake efficiency. Training is perhaps the most crucial factor, as consistent and targeted exercise can significantly improve endurance. Nutrition provides the fuel our bodies need to sustain activity, while sleep allows for recovery and repair. Stress, both physical and mental, can drain stamina, and age inevitably brings about changes in our physiological capacity. Let's break down why unlimited energy isn't sustainable and what we can do to manage our energy levels more effectively. Energy, in a biological sense, comes from the food we eat. Our bodies convert carbohydrates, fats, and proteins into ATP (adenosine triphosphate), the primary energy currency of cells. This ATP fuels everything we do, from breathing and thinking to running and lifting weights. The amount of ATP our bodies can produce and utilize is limited by factors such as genetics, training, nutrition, and recovery. While we can certainly improve our energy production and efficiency through training and lifestyle choices, we can't simply create an unlimited supply. One of the biggest reasons unlimited energy is unsustainable is the concept of energy debt. When we expend more energy than we replenish, we create an energy deficit. This deficit can manifest in various ways, including fatigue, decreased performance, increased risk of injury, and even hormonal imbalances. Constantly pushing ourselves beyond our limits without adequate rest and recovery is like trying to drive a car on an empty tank – eventually, it's going to break down. Factors That Impact Stamina: The Real Deal

Stamina, that elusive quality that allows us to push through challenges and sustain effort over time, is something many of us strive for. But what exactly impacts stamina, and why does it seem to fluctuate? Let's get real about the factors that affect stamina, from the physiological to the lifestyle-related, and how you can optimize your endurance. Think of stamina as a complex equation with multiple variables. It's not just about how much you train; it's about a holistic approach that encompasses your genetics, fitness level, nutrition, sleep, stress management, and even your environment. Let's break down these factors one by one. First up, genetics. Yes, your genes play a role in your baseline stamina. They influence things like your muscle fiber composition (the ratio of slow-twitch to fast-twitch fibers), your cardiovascular capacity, and your oxygen uptake efficiency. Some individuals are simply predisposed to greater endurance capabilities. However, genetics are not destiny. While you can't change your genes, you can certainly optimize your stamina through training and lifestyle choices. Training is arguably the most significant factor in improving stamina. Consistent and targeted exercise can dramatically increase your endurance. Endurance training, such as running, cycling, or swimming, improves your cardiovascular system, making it more efficient at delivering oxygen to your muscles. It also increases the number of mitochondria in your muscle cells, which are the powerhouses that produce energy. The type of training you do also matters. Interval training, which alternates between high-intensity bursts and periods of rest or low-intensity activity, can be particularly effective for boosting stamina. It challenges your body in different ways and improves both aerobic and anaerobic capacity. Nutrition is the fuel that powers your stamina. A balanced diet that provides adequate carbohydrates, proteins, and fats is essential for sustained energy. Carbohydrates are the primary fuel source for endurance activities, so ensuring you have enough glycogen stores (stored carbohydrates in your muscles and liver) is crucial. Protein is important for muscle repair and recovery, while fats provide a longer-lasting source of energy. Hydration is also critical for stamina. Dehydration can significantly impair performance, leading to fatigue and decreased endurance. Drink plenty of water throughout the day, especially before, during, and after exercise. Sleep is often overlooked, but it's a vital component of stamina. During sleep, your body repairs and recovers from the day's activities. Sleep deprivation can lead to fatigue, decreased motivation, and impaired cognitive function, all of which can negatively impact stamina. Aim for 7-9 hours of quality sleep per night to optimize your endurance. Stress can be a major stamina killer. Chronic stress triggers the release of stress hormones like cortisol, which can interfere with energy production, impair immune function, and lead to fatigue. Managing stress through techniques like meditation, yoga, or spending time in nature can help protect your stamina. Age is another factor that inevitably impacts stamina. As we age, our physiological capacity naturally declines. Muscle mass decreases, cardiovascular function diminishes, and hormone levels change. However, this doesn't mean you have to give up on stamina as you get older. Regular exercise and a healthy lifestyle can help mitigate the effects of aging and maintain a good level of endurance. Finally, your environment can also affect stamina. Factors like heat, humidity, and altitude can all impact your performance. Heat and humidity can increase your heart rate and cause fatigue, while altitude reduces the amount of oxygen available, making endurance activities more challenging. Understanding these factors and how they interact is the key to optimizing your stamina. It's not just about pushing yourself harder; it's about taking a holistic approach that addresses all aspects of your well-being. Remember, guys, stamina is a marathon, not a sprint. By focusing on long-term sustainable strategies, you can build and maintain your endurance for years to come.

The Importance of Rest and Recovery: Avoiding Burnout

In the pursuit of fitness and peak performance, it's easy to get caught up in the hustle. We push ourselves harder, train more frequently, and strive for constant progress. But in this relentless pursuit, we often neglect one crucial element: rest and recovery. The importance of rest and recovery cannot be overstated, especially when it comes to avoiding burnout and sustaining long-term stamina. Think of rest and recovery as the yin to exercise's yang. They are complementary forces that work together to create balance and harmony. Exercise breaks down muscle tissue and depletes energy stores. Rest and recovery allow your body to rebuild and replenish, making you stronger and more resilient. Neglecting rest and recovery is like trying to build a house without a foundation – it might look good for a while, but eventually, it will crumble. Burnout is a state of physical, emotional, and mental exhaustion caused by prolonged or excessive stress. It's a common pitfall for athletes and fitness enthusiasts who push themselves too hard without allowing adequate recovery. Burnout can manifest in various ways, including fatigue, decreased motivation, increased risk of injury, mood swings, and even a decline in performance. It's a serious condition that can take a toll on your overall well-being. One of the key reasons rest and recovery are so important is that they allow your body to adapt to the stress of training. When you exercise, you create microscopic tears in your muscle fibers. During rest, your body repairs these tears and rebuilds the muscle tissue, making it stronger than before. This process is known as supercompensation. If you don't allow adequate rest, your muscles don't have time to fully recover, and you risk overtraining. Overtraining is a state of chronic fatigue and decreased performance caused by excessive training without sufficient rest. It can lead to a host of problems, including muscle soreness, fatigue, insomnia, decreased appetite, and increased susceptibility to illness. Rest and recovery also play a crucial role in replenishing energy stores. During exercise, your body uses glycogen, the stored form of carbohydrates, as its primary fuel source. After a workout, your glycogen stores are depleted and need to be replenished. Eating a balanced diet that includes carbohydrates and protein helps to refuel your muscles and liver. Sleep is another essential component of rest and recovery. During sleep, your body releases growth hormone, which is crucial for muscle repair and growth. Sleep deprivation can impair muscle recovery and lead to fatigue. Aim for 7-9 hours of quality sleep per night to optimize your recovery. So, what does rest and recovery look like in practice? It's not just about taking days off from exercise; it's about incorporating a variety of recovery strategies into your routine. Active recovery, such as light cardio or stretching, can help to improve blood flow and reduce muscle soreness. Foam rolling and massage can also help to release muscle tension and promote recovery. Prioritizing sleep and managing stress are also crucial for recovery. Taking time for relaxation and stress-reducing activities, such as meditation or spending time in nature, can help to prevent burnout. It's also important to listen to your body and recognize the signs of overtraining. If you're feeling unusually fatigued, sore, or unmotivated, it's a sign that you need to back off and prioritize recovery. Remember, guys, rest and recovery are not signs of weakness; they are essential components of a successful training program. By prioritizing rest and recovery, you can avoid burnout, sustain long-term stamina, and achieve your fitness goals.

Adapting Your Training: Smart Strategies for Sustained Stamina

Sustained stamina isn't about endless pushing, it's about smart training and intelligent adaptation. As we evolve and our bodies change, our training approaches need to evolve too. If you're realizing you're not the unlimited stamina guy you once were, it's not a setback – it's an opportunity to refine your strategy. Let's dive into some smart strategies for adapting your training to maintain and even enhance your stamina for the long haul. The first thing to recognize is that progressive overload is a fundamental principle of training. This means gradually increasing the demands on your body over time to stimulate adaptation and improvement. However, progressive overload doesn't mean simply adding more and more volume or intensity indefinitely. It's about finding the right balance between pushing yourself and allowing your body to recover. One of the most effective ways to adapt your training is through periodization. Periodization involves dividing your training year into different phases, each with a specific focus. These phases might include a base-building phase, a strength phase, a power phase, and a competition or peak performance phase. By varying your training stimulus, you can prevent plateaus, reduce the risk of injury, and optimize your performance. Another key strategy is to incorporate variety into your training. Doing the same workouts day after day can lead to boredom and burnout, and it can also limit your progress. Try different types of exercises, modalities, and training protocols to challenge your body in new ways. For example, if you're a runner, you might incorporate cross-training activities like swimming or cycling into your routine. If you're a weightlifter, you might experiment with different rep ranges, sets, and exercises. Listening to your body is also crucial for adapting your training. Pay attention to how you're feeling, both physically and mentally. If you're consistently feeling fatigued, sore, or unmotivated, it's a sign that you need to back off and prioritize recovery. Don't be afraid to take rest days, deload weeks, or even adjust your training plan if necessary. Nutrition and hydration play a significant role in sustained stamina. Make sure you're fueling your body with a balanced diet that provides adequate carbohydrates, protein, and fats. Experiment with timing your nutrient intake around your workouts to optimize energy levels and recovery. Stay properly hydrated by drinking plenty of water throughout the day. Sleep is the cornerstone of recovery, and it's essential for sustained stamina. Aim for 7-9 hours of quality sleep per night to allow your body to repair and rebuild. Create a relaxing bedtime routine, avoid caffeine and alcohol before bed, and make sure your sleep environment is dark, quiet, and cool. Stress management is another crucial aspect of adapting your training. Chronic stress can interfere with energy production, impair immune function, and lead to fatigue. Incorporate stress-reducing activities into your routine, such as meditation, yoga, or spending time in nature. Finally, don't be afraid to seek professional guidance. A qualified coach or trainer can help you develop a personalized training plan that takes your individual needs, goals, and limitations into account. They can also provide valuable feedback and support to help you stay on track. Remember, guys, adapting your training is an ongoing process. It's about being flexible, listening to your body, and making adjustments as needed. By implementing these smart strategies, you can maintain and even enhance your stamina for the long haul, regardless of whether you're still the unlimited stamina guy or not.
